So, after having a salon microdermabrasion done several times (almost $500 ago) decided to purchase this particular one for several reasons. First, the suction at max setting is comparable to most salon machines, based on a review of several different home machines. Second, it uses diamond rather than crystal heads, and finally, who wants to pay in the excess of hundred bucks for every treatment....my experience is that even at the maximum setting, the NEWDERMO Microderm system is much more gentle than salon treatment....in terms on how it felt during the procedure. Also, my skin was substantially more red after the salon treatment. However, next day, I couldn’t tell much difference between the two treatments....which is good. The skin was smooth and radiant and noticed neck wrinkles and crow feet are less visible. For the reference, I’m 48yrs old...skin looks younger....no doubt. It’s possible that the salon treatment is more powerful and as such having a greater impact and therefore needs to be repeated within weeks or months, whereas NEWDERMO Microderm is more gentle but can be and maybe should be done 1-2 per week....I have the feeling that the final result is more less the same, and at much better price. The device works well, it’s easy to set it up and use it in either auto or manual mode. It comes with two identical diamond heads, a bunch of filers (20 or 30 pcs) and a very short instructional booklet. Eventually the heads, the filters and an O ring will have to purchased, as those are consumables. I do think the manufacturer could have added more technical information on suction strength for each of the settings, about how the whole the thing works and what does it do....yes, we can find all that online. Anyhow, the booklet and device screen offer good enough guidance on how to use it on a specific area of the skin. For now I give it 4 star since I only used it once since I received it last week and want to see how long it lasts....there is 1yr manufacturing warranty so I guess I’m giving it a 5th star for that. |
